Job DescriptionCyient WorkdayNew Britain, CTAbout the Role:Cyient is looking for a CNC Lathe Machinist to join our team in New Britain, CT. This position will be working CNC Lathes (horizontal or vertical).You Will: Plan machining by studying work orders, blueprints, engineering plans, materials, specifications, orthographic drawings, reference planes, locations of surfaces, and machining parameters; interpreting geometric dimensions and tolerances (GD&T). Program lathes by entering instructions, including zero and reference points; setting tool registers, offsets, compensation, and conditional switches; calculating requirements, including basic math, geometry, and trigonometry; proving part programs. Sets up lathes by installing and adjusting three- and four-jaw chucks. Set up tooling. Verify settings by measuring positions, first-run part, and sample workpieces. Maintain specifications by observing drilling, grooving, and cutting, including turning, facing, knurling and thread chasing operations; taking measurements; detecting malfunctions; troubleshooting processes; adjusting and reprogramming controls; sharpening and replacing worn tools; adhering to quality assurance procedures and processes. Maintain safe operations by adhering to safety procedures and regulations. Maintain equipment by completing preventive maintenance requirements; following manufacturer's instructions; troubleshooting malfunctions; calling for repairs. Update job knowledge by participating in educational opportunities; reading technical publications. Accomplish organization goals by accepting ownership for accomplishing new and different requests; exploring opportunities to add value to job accomplishments. You'll Need: 2 years' experience OR Machining Certificate Ability to set up and run machines in non production environment Aerospace experience is a plus Ability to program is a plus Skills & ExperienceCNC Machines, CNC Programming, Fanuc CNCCyient is an Equal Opportunity Employer.
